PHP保留兩位小數的方法

2021-09-29 20:48:26 字數 536 閱讀 8956

$num = 45610.4567;

echo $num;

echo "

";//第一種:利用round()對浮點數進行四捨五入

echo "利用round()對浮點數進行四捨五入: " . round($num,2);

echo "

";//第二種:利用sprintf格式化字串

$format_num = sprintf("%.2f",$num);

echo "利用sprintf格式化字串: " . $format_num;

echo "

";//第三種:利用千位分組來格式化數字的函式number_format()

echo "利用千位分組來格式化數字的函式: " . number_format($num, 2);

echo "

";//或者如下

echo "利用千位分組來格式化數字的函式: " . number_format($num, 2, '.', ''); //10/46

php保留兩位小數

1.不進製的情況 比如3.149569取小數點後兩位,最後兩位不能四捨五入。結果 3.14。可以使用floor 函式 該函式是舍去取整。例如,floor 4.66456 結果 4 floor 9.1254 結果9 因此,去小數點後兩位,需要先乘以100,然後舍去取整,再除以100,即 a floor...

php保留兩位小叔 php保留兩位小數的方法

如下所示 num 10.4567 第一種 利用round 對浮點數進行四捨五入 echo round num,2 第二種 利用sprintf格式化字串 format num sprintf 2f num echo format num 第三種 利用千位分組來格式化數字的函式number format...

php數字兩位小數 PHP保留兩位小數的幾種方法

如下所示 num 10.4567 第一種 利用round 對浮點數進行四捨五入 echo round num,2 第二種 利用sprintf格式化字串 format num sprintf 2f num echo format num 第三種 利用千位分組來格式化數字的函式number format...